Community Library Service Centre Assistant

Rolleston, New Zealand

Reference: 6668348


About the role:

We welcome you to apply for a role as a casual Community Library Service Centre Assistant in our Arts, Culture and Lifelong Learning Team (ACLL), where you will contribute to a network of welcoming, professional, and responsive library and service centres. You will have the opportunity to work across a range of days and shifts providing cover for leave and assistance during busy periods as required across our four locations (Darfield, Leeston and Lincoln Libraries & Service Centres, and Te Ara Ātea in Rolleston) and our Edge Connector Vehicle.

You will be working with the ACLL whānau who are committed to serving Selwyn communities and making a difference across the district. Our team have diverse backgrounds and bring themselves, their interests, and passion to their mahi.

In this role you will use your excellent customer service skills to host to a diverse range of people from the Selwyn District and afar. Visitors to our sites come to experience our dynamic public library services and to access Council services (such as paying their rates or registering their dog) and government services (such as meeting with Inland Revenue). No day is the same and full training will be given to the successful applicants.

Responsibilities for this role include, but are not limited to;
  • Welcoming and interacting with people from all ages and walks of life
  • Providing technology assistance and help with digital resources.
  • Assisting the community with Council and library services
  • Helping people connect to central government and wider community services through the Heartlands initiative.
  • Finding, recommending, and shelving books and helping to keep our collections looking great

About you:

Our casual team works across all our locations and days of the week (including evening and weekend work), so you will need to be flexible, adaptable, and work in a collaborative and positive way. You enjoy working with others and are naturally able to relate to a wide range of people, including tamariki and rangatahi. Reliability, excellent communication, and taking initiative will be keys to success in this role. You have strong digital skills along with a good understanding of the kaupapa of a modern public library service.
